Detailed explanation-1: -Skin color is mainly determined by a pigment called melanin. Melanin is produced by melanocytes through a process called melanogenesis. The difference in skin color between lightly and darkly pigmented individuals is due to their level of melanocyte activity; it is not due to the number of melanocytes in their skin.

Detailed explanation-2: -Skin color is determined by a pigment (melanin) made by specialized cells in the skin (melanocytes). The amount and type of melanin determines a person’s skin color.

Detailed explanation-3: -According to Bhanusali, the shade that eventually develops is dictated by the ratios of two types of melanin: eumelanin, which manifests as brown and black pigment, and pheomelanin, which appears as red and yellow.
